Through the Glass is inspired by writer-director Victoria Lynn Weston's own out-of-body experience while helping a dear friend through his life transition. The moment was so profound, she felt compelled to share it through film.
Visually poetic and emotionally grounded, the film explores the invisible threads between life and death - where love transcends form, and no one truly crosses over alone.
